Landscape of Grand Pré Incorporated is a charitable organization based in Wolfville, Nova Scotia, classified by the CRA under public amenities. It appears on the charity register the way hospitals, universities, and other publicly funded bodies do — to issue tax receipts — rather than as a donation-driven charity in the usual sense. In its fiscal year ending March 31, 2024, it reported $228K in revenue and $228K in expenditures.

Its funding that year was roughly 77% from government. Government funding is the majority of its budget.

Compared with 686 public-amenity institutions of similar size, its share of spending on mission — charitable programs plus grants to other charities — ranked above 11% of peers. Its highest-paid position fell in the $80,000–119,999 range. The charity reported 1 permanent full-time position.

Its filed list of directors and trustees shows 9 names.

In its own words

Programs to protect and preserve the landscape of grand pre unesco world heritage site in grand pre ns. Education to the public and increase awareness of the landscape of grand pre unesco heritage site and its history.

Ongoing-program description from its T3010 filing, verbatim.
